Listen to the conversation, mark each statement as either True (T)or False (F)according to your listening.
W: Hi, Simon, how are you? How is your new car going?
M: Oh, don’t ask me, Anna. It’s a nightmare! I never should have bought it!
W: Why? What’s wrong? I thought you’d got one of those fancy new models?
M: I did, but that’s part of the problem. If I’d bought a second-hand car, I wouldn’t have taken out this big bank loan I’ve got now.
W: Oh, so I suppose you’ve got big repayments to make?
M: Yes, and I can’t sell the car until I’ve paid for it. But it’s not only that. I had no idea running a car was going to be so expensive! I wish I’d thought about the other costs before I bought it.
W: It probably wouldn’t be so bad if the price of petrol hadn’t almost doubled last month.
M: Don’t remind me—the petrol alone is costing me a fortune!
W: Lucky you’ve got that part-time job then!
M: That’s just the thing. Nearly all of my wages are going on the car. If I’d waited a bit before buying the car, I’d have managed to save quite a bit by now. I might even have gone on that college trip last week: it sounded great.
W: Oh, dear. Can’t you ask your dad to help you out?
M: No way! When my granddad left me some money, my dad didn’t want me to spend it on a car. If only I’d listened to him, none of this would have happened! I wish he wasn’t always right!
W: Well, maybe you should value his opinions more. You do seem to argue with him a lot. If you got on better with him, you might have listened to his suggestions.
M: The worst thing is, Dad wanted me to buy some shares with the money and now they’ve gone up by thirty per cent. I should have listened to him. If I’d taken his advice, I’d own a small fortune now instead of a big debt!
W: Oh, Simon, you poor thing. I wish I could help you but I have even less money than you. At least you have a car!
M: Oh, don’t say that! I wish I’d never bought the car! If it weren’t for the car, I’d have no money worries now.
